1.Structure of Electrolytic Tinplate Sheets for Tin Cans Making Description

 

Electrolytic Tin Plate Coils and Sheets for Foods Metal Packaging,  is one thin steel sheet with a coating of tin applied by electrolytic deposition. Tinplate made by this process is essentially a sandwich in which the central core is strip steel. This core is cleaned in a pickling solution and then fed through tanks containing electrolyte, where tin is deposited on both sides. As the strip passes between high-frequency electric induction coils, it is heated so that the tin coating melts and flows to form a lustrous coat.

 

2.Main Features of the Electrolytic Tinplate Sheets for Tin Cans Making

 

Appearance – Electrolytic Tin Plate is characterized by its beautiful metallic luster. Products with various kinds of surface roughness are produced by selecting the surface finish of the substrate steel sheet.

Paintability and printability – Electrolytic Tin Plates have excellent paintability and printability. Printing is beautifully finished using various lacquers and inks.

Formability and strength – Electrolytic Tin Plates have got very good formability and strength. By selecting a proper temper grade, appropriate formability is obtained for different applications as well as the required strength after forming.

Corrosion resistance – Tinplate has got good corrosion resistance. By selecting a proper coating weight, appropriate corrosion resistance is obtained against container contents. Coated items should meet 24 hour 5 % salt spray requirement.

Solderability and weldability – Electrolytic Tin Plates can be joined both by soldering or welding. These properties of tinplate are used for making various types of cans.

Hygienic – Tin coating provides good and non toxic barrier properties to protect food products from impurities, bacteria, moisture, light and odours.

Safe – Tinplate being low weight and high strength makes food cans easy to ship and transport.

Eco friendly – Tinplate offers 100 % recyclability.

Tin is not good for low temperature applications since it changes structure and loses adhesion when exposed to temperatures below – 40 deg C.

4.Electrolytic Tinplate Sheets for Tin Cans Making Specification

Standard

ISO 11949 -1995,         GB/T2520-2000,JIS G3303,ASTM A623, BS EN 10202

 

Material

MR,SPCC

Thickness

0.15mm - 0.50mm

Width

600mm -1150mm

Temper

T1-T5

Annealing

BA & CA

Coil Inner         Diameter

508mm

Weight

6-10         tons/coil 1~1.7 tons/sheets   bundle

Passivation

311

Oil

DOS 

Surface

Finish,bright,stone,matte,silver

 

5.FAQ of Electrolytic Tinplate Sheets for Tin Cans Making

 

- How are the Electrolytic Tin Plates specified?

  The Electrolytic Tin Plates are specified as per the steel base, extent of tempering, the coating weight, annealing method and the surface finish.

- How many types there are for base steels?

The base steels are of three types: Type MR, L, D

Q: How is tinplate coated with organic coatings?
Tinplate is coated with organic coatings through a process known as coil coating. In this process, the tinplate is cleaned and pre-treated to ensure proper adhesion of the organic coating. The organic coating, usually a resin-based material, is then applied to the tinplate in a continuous and uniform manner. The coated tinplate is then cured, either through heat or UV radiation, to ensure the coating adheres firmly to the surface. This coating provides protection against corrosion and enhances the appearance of the tinplate.

Q: Does tinplate affect the taste or quality of food?
Yes, tinplate can affect the taste and quality of food. Tinplate containers or cans may sometimes impart a metallic taste to the food, especially acidic or highly seasoned products. Additionally, if the tin coating is damaged or corroded, it can lead to chemical reactions with the food, potentially compromising its quality and safety.
